if - like Sprite - you have portrait pictures rotating to landscape then please check your camera settings.

I recently did a site update that uses the rotation info off the EXIF data written into the photo file by the camera. It tells the upload what orientation the image was when taken, and the upload rotates accordingly. If you have the oposite problem of portait image uploading into landscape either there is no EXIF data to use to rotate, or the EXIF data is wrong. ☹
